After back to back losses, things won't get any easier for the Tide as #17 Nebraska pulls into Sewell-Thomas tonight for the first of a three game series.  The mid-week losses dropped Alabama to 12-4 on the season, while the Huskers are sporting a 6-4 record.  For more info on the Huskers' season, check out Corn Nation.

Last season's series saw the Tide swept in Lincoln before winning 13 of the next 18 and the SEC title.  Although our batting average is better this time around (.323 vs .263), there are still questions facing the Tide heading into tonight's game, with pitching at the top of the list.  Alabama had to use three relievers in it's last two losses, and how they bounce back will be crucial in the first "premiere series" of the season.

Alabama's scheduled rotation is sophomore left-hander Miers Quigley (2-0, 1.48 ERA), sophomore right-hander Casey Kebodeaux (2-1, 142), and senior right-hander Bernard Robert (2-0, 1.80).

Robert pitched Tuesday and Kebodeaux threw 2 2/3 innings in relief Wednesday.

Sophomore Tommy Hunter (ankle) is expected to be available, and depending on how the series progresses could start. He's 2-1, with a 1.89 ERA.

Tonight's game is set to start at 6:30, and you can listen in on the Crimson Tide Sports Network.
